76-20-06 HILLER AVIATION: Amendment 39-2740. Applies to Model UH-12D and UH-12E Helicopters which have been converted to turbine power in accordance with Soloy Conversions, Limited, STC Nos. SH177WE and SH178WE respectively certificated in all categories. Compliance required as indicated.
To prevent loss of helicopter control due to freezing of the governor cable, throttle cable, and/or anti-ice cable accomplish the following:
(A) Within 15 days time in service after the receipt of this telegraphic AD, install a placard in view of the pilot which states:
"Flight in outside air temperature of 32 degrees F. or lower is prohibited."
(B) Within 60 days time in service after the receipt of this telegraphic AD, perform the modifications contained in Soloy Conversions, Ltd., Service Bulletin 01-560 dated September 3, 1976, or later FAA approved revisions.
(C) The operation restriction prescribed in (A) above may be discontinued and the placard may be removed when the control cable modifications required by (B) above have been completed.
(D) Equivalent procedures may be approved by the Chief, Engineering and Manufacturing Branch, FAA Northwest Region, upon the submission of adequate substantiating data.
